4. Setup

4.1 Battery Installation

Diagram showing battery compartment and Type-C port for dual power supply options.

Image: The monitor's dual power supply options, showing the battery compartment for 4 AAA batteries and a Type-C 5V, 1A port.

  1. Open the battery compartment cover on the back of the monitor.
  2. Insert the 4 AAA batteries (included) according to the polarity indicators (+ and -) inside the compartment.
  3. Close the battery compartment cover securely.

Alternatively, the device can be powered via a Type-C 5V, 1A power supply (cable not included). This option allows for temporary use without batteries.

4.2 Cuff Connection

  1. Locate the air jack on the side of the main unit.
  2. Firmly insert the air plug of the arm cuff into the air jack until it clicks into place.

5. Operating Instructions

5.1 Proper Measurement Technique

Four-step guide on how to take proper blood pressure measurements.

Image: A visual guide demonstrating the four steps for accurate blood pressure measurement.

  1. Step 1: Insert the air plug into the air jack securely. Place your hand through the cuff loop. Pull the cuff until it reaches your upper left arm.
  2. Step 2: The bottom edge of the arm cuff should be 0.8-1.2 inches (2-3 cm) above the inside elbow.
  3. Step 3: The arm cuff should be placed on your arm at the same level as your heart, with the arm resting comfortably on a table.
  4. Step 4: Press the "START" button. If you feel uncomfortable during the measurement, press the "START" button again to immediately stop the measure.

5.2 Applying the Cuff

Adjustable arm cuff with size range and cuff worn detection indicator.

Image: The adjustable arm cuff (8.6-16.5 inches) and the 'OK' indicator for correct cuff placement.

Ensure the cuff is wrapped snugly around your upper arm, approximately 2-3 cm above the elbow. The air tube should be positioned on the inside of your arm, aligned with your middle finger. The monitor features a Cuff Worn Detection system, displaying an "OK" icon on the screen when the cuff is correctly wrapped, ensuring accurate readings.

5.3 Taking a Measurement

With the cuff correctly applied and your arm positioned at heart level, simply press the START/STOP button. The cuff will automatically inflate and then slowly deflate, taking your measurement. Remain still and avoid talking during the measurement process.

5.5 Irregular Heartbeat Detection

Monitor displaying an irregular heartbeat icon on the screen.

Image: The irregular heartbeat icon appearing on the monitor's screen, indicating a detected irregular heartbeat.

The monitor is equipped with an Irregular Heartbeat Alert. If an irregular heartbeat is detected during the measurement, a specific icon will appear on the screen. If this icon appears frequently, consult your doctor.

5.6 Posture Detection

Examples of incorrect posture during blood pressure measurement.

Image: Visual examples of incorrect postures to avoid during measurement to ensure accuracy.

The device includes Posture Detection to help ensure accurate readings. It will alert you if your posture is incorrect during measurement, prompting you to adjust for optimal results. Always sit upright with your back supported, feet flat on the floor, and arm resting on a table at heart level.

5.7 Dual-User Mode

Monitor showing dual user profiles (User A and User B) each with 99 memory slots.

Image: The dual-user mode feature, allowing two individuals to store up to 99 readings each.

The Sinocare ARM-30E+ supports two user profiles (User 1 and User 2), each capable of storing up to 99 readings. This feature is ideal for families to track and compare historical data. To switch between users, press the SET button. To view stored readings, press the MEM button.

6. Maintenance

6.1 Cleaning

Wipe the monitor and cuff with a soft, dry cloth. Do not use abrasive cleaners or immerse the device in water. Keep the device clean and free from dust.

6.2 Storage

Store the device in a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ight, extreme temperatures, and humidity. Avoid strong impact or direct exposure to corrosive gas. If the device will not be used for an extended period, remove the batteries.

7. Troubleshooting

7.1 Inaccurate Readings

The primary causes of inaccurate blood pressure readings can include:

  • Incorrect Measurement Method: Engaging in vigorous exercise or experiencing emotional fluctuations within 30 minutes prior to measurement, or improper positioning and cuff application.
  • Equipment Malfunction: Battery power depletion, or internal components damaged by moisture.
  • Physiological and Environmental Interference: Atrial fibrillation and arrhythmia can make it difficult for electronic blood pressure monitors to accurately capture signals; noisy measurement environments can interfere with electronic device signals.

Ensure correct cuff placement, proper posture, and a calm environment for accurate results. If issues persist, refer to the full instruction manual or contact customer support.

8. Specifications

  • Product Dimensions: 4.6 x 2.5 x 3.9 inches; 14.39 ounces (118mm x 98mm x 62.5mm)
  • Item Model Number: ARM-30E+
  • Batteries: 4 AAA batteries required (included)
  • Power Source: Battery Powered or DC 5V, 1A Type-C charging cable (not included)
  • Display Type: LCD
  • Cuff Size: 22-42 cm (8.6-16.5 inches)
  • Age Range (Description): Adult
  • Number of Users: 2 (with 99 memories each)
  • Cuff Pressure Accuracy: ±3 mmHg (±0.4 kPa)
  • Pulse Rate Accuracy: ±5%
  • Measurement Range: SYS: 57-255 mmHg (7.6-34.0 kPa), DIA: 25-195 mmHg (3.3-26.0 kPa), Pulse rate: 40-199 bpm
  • Operating Environment: Temperature: 5°C-40°C, Humidity: 15%-90%RH, Atmospheric condition: 70kPa-106 kPa
  • Transportation and Storage Environment: Temperature: -20°C-55°C, Humidity: 10%-93%RH, Atmospheric condition: 70kPa-106 kPa
